Terraform vpc endpoint s3 example

private. The endpoint policy allows only the s3:GetObject action on the specified bucket. To use the bucket where the infrastructure state is stored, we applied the following Terraform code: terraform { backend "s3" { bucket = "my-blockchain-structure-bucket-us-east-1" key = "path/to/my-env/my-blockchain-structure" region = "us-east-1" dynamodb_table = "terraform-locks-my-blockchain-structure-us-east-1" encrypt = true } }. aws_vpcs. To use the bucket where the infrastructure state is stored, we applied the following Terraform code: terraform { backend "s3" { bucket = "my-blockchain-structure-bucket-us-east-1" key = "path/to/my-env/my-blockchain-structure" region = "us-east-1" dynamodb_table = "terraform-locks-my-blockchain-structure-us-east-1" encrypt = true } }. The gateway endpoint is only available in the region it is created, so you need to create it in. Create IAM Role to access S3 Create Linux Server and Install/Enable Apache2 Enable VCP Endpoint Setting up the Environment Before we start creating the infrastructure, we need to set up the. s3" } Basic w/ Tags resource "aws_vpc_endpoint" "s3" { vpc_id = aws_vpc. amazonaws. . . This module's default policy allows all access but can be overriden via TF variable s3_vpc_endpoint_policy. $ {var. Luckily you can also create your own robust custom policy. ecr. 0. For example, in the VPC endpoint policy, you can add a condition as shown in the following snippet: "Condition": { "ArnNotLikeIfExists": { "s3:DataAccessPointArn":. ACM (Certificate Manager) ACM PCA (Certificate Manager Private Certificate Authority) AMP (Managed Prometheus) API Gateway API Gateway V2 Account Management Amplify App Mesh App Runner AppConfig AppFlow AppIntegrations AppStream 2. It is recommended the VPC containing the Terraform Enterprise servers be configured with a VPC endpoint for S3. . We will create a module “sqs” to create SQS Queue. Jun 22, 2022 · VPC endpoint Terraform example setup Raw how-to. It is recommended the VPC containing the Terraform Enterprise servers be configured with a VPC endpoint for S3. The following IAM policy statement requires the principal to access AWS only from the specified network range. While in the Console, click on the search bar at the top, search for ‘vpc’, and click on the VPC menu item. If you want to connect to S3 or DynamoDB VPC Endpoint Gateway is the better choice and is cost-efficient. Gérer plusieurs VPC et assurer la cohérence de. Oct 21, 2022 · In this example, the VPC endpoint ID (vpce-id) is vpce-07ada758f42d9b493 and the DNS name is *. . This is useful for route tables managed by Kops for example. s3-global. To use a single NAT gateway, set multi_az_nat_gateway = 0 and single_nat_gateway = 1 in terraform. s3 Endpoint for pulling container images. . vpce. . . 04, lambda, API ENDPOINT-Continuous delivery / Continuous developpement: Ansible, Jenkin;. Service Endpoint Gateways are only available for S3 and DynamoDB. Configure the VPC Endpoints for S3, DKR, and logging. In addition to all arguments above, the following attributes are exported: arn - Amazon Resource Name (ARN) of cluster. vpce. amazonaws. In addition to all arguments above, the following attributes are exported: arn - Amazon Resource Name (ARN) of cluster. Jun 1, 2022 · Adding a VPC endpoint to your private subnet using Terraform Adding a VPC endpoint using Terraform is pretty straightforward. 3) Suite à cela, nous déployons la partie web grâce à notre pipeline nommé "Deploy_Web" en créant : - 1 ELB (Elastic Load Balancing) - 1 ASG (Auto Scaling Groups) Tous ces éléments sont créés en utilisant Terraform. S3 bucket and IAM policies still apply. Check out my article for setting up VPC Endpoint Gateway. 8. It seems less radical, than deleting S3. . Share Improve this. My terraform: policy = jsonencode({ Sid = "Restrict-Access-To-Specific-Bucket" Principal = &q. The configuration in this directory creates an AWS Lambda Function deployed within a VPC with a VPC Endpoint. Under Service Name, select a com.

Popular posts